Diego Armando Maradona’s death trial has produced another assessment of how his final days should have been handled: an expert said the Argentine star ought to have been admitted to a rehabilitation facility.
The testimony adds to proceedings that continue to examine the circumstances surrounding Maradona’s last days. The case was being heard near Buenos Aires, where his nephew Jonathan Espósito was seen leaving court after one of the hearings.
